### Resolver batching

The old schema fired one lookup per order line — classic N+1. We now batch through the Quillbatch dataloader, so a 200-line order costs exactly two queries. Don't bypass the loader in new resolvers, please. To hit the batching service from a local environment, use the key below.

service key, yadug-bajog: zpat3_pou

Handover — Marquessa seat-map renderer

For review: I've split the seat-map renderer for the Orpheum Vale theatre into a layout pass and a paint pass. The layout pass now handles curved balcony rows correctly; the paint pass caches glyphs per zoom level. Watch for the accessibility-seat overlay — it must render above the hold state. The renderer reads its tuning from the values that follow.

settings of fafog-haduf:
ZORIX_PIN=4648
ZORIX_METRICS_HOST=metrics.zorix.paliqsys.corp
ZORIX_LOG_LEVEL=info
ZORIX_TENANT=druix

Ticket: the Lanternmap autocomplete widget is throwing a cryptic null in the suggestion renderer whenever someone types a unit number before the street name. It's not crashing the page, but the dropdown just goes blank, which is arguably worse. Repro is easy: type "4b elm" in any checkout form on staging. If you get paged for this tonight, just roll the widget back. The last known-good build is noted below.

trace token, fafog-kageg: htk4_98e6